Richard Barber/Miles Kington - Folio Society: The Pastons/The Pick of Punch - 1998

Richard Barber's "The Pastons" and Miles Kington's "The Pick of Punch" both represent the rich tapestry of British history and culture. Both volumes are beautifully presented by the Folio Society, providing readers with a deep literary dive, enriched with engaging narratives. The Pastons by Richard Barber (Folio Society, 2001) "The Pastons" by Richard Barber offers an intimate glimpse into the life of a prominent family during one of the most tumultuous periods in English history: the Wars of the Roses. Through the Paston family's extensive collection of letters, Barber weaves a vivid narrative that brings to life the daily struggles, ambitions, and intrigues of 15th-century England. This volume, published by the Folio Society in 2001, is meticulously edited and provides insightful commentary regarding medieval history and the personal stories behind historical events. The Pick of Punch by Miles Kington (Folio Society, 1998) Miles Kington's "The Pick of Punch" is a delightful anthology that captures the wit and humor of "Punch" magazine, a British institution known for its satirical take on contemporary life and politics. This 1998 Folio Society edition compiles some of the best cartoons, articles, and essays from the magazine's long history, showcasing the brilliant and often irreverent humor that made "Punch" a beloved publication. Kington's selection and commentary highlight the magazine's unique ability to reflect and critique society, making this book a joyous read for fans of British humor and cultural commentary.
